Key Responsibilities:

  • Field Service Activities:

    • Perform on-site valve repairs, potentially requiring travel across the UK and worldwide offshore locations.
    • Respond to customer on-call requirements.
    • Disassemble, assemble, and test various valves, actuators, and instrumentation following QA/QC and Health and Safety procedures.
    • Occasionally act as site supervisor during shutdowns, overseeing planning, workforce supervision, and customer updates.
  • Workshop Support:

    • Collaborate with senior fitters and provide assistance as needed.
    • Deliver training under the guidance of the workshop charge hand and workshop manager.
  • Health, Safety & Environment:

    • Show commitment to Health, Safety, and Environmental management systems.
  • Quality Management System:

    • Ensure compliance with the Quality Management System and relevant procedures.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Job Knowledge:

    • Expertise in various valves (Control, Choke, Butterfly, Isolation, PSV), actuators, and instrumentation.
    •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work on-site to find solutions for technical issues.
    • Competence validated through our rigorous company competence scheme.
  • Education and Experience:

    • Higher National Certificates/Diplomas or equivalent from college.
    • Engineering Apprenticeship.
  • Core Competencies:

    • Analytical and problem-solving skills.
    • Technical expertise.
    • Excellent customer service.
    • Strong oral and written communication.
    • Effective teamwork.
